Mirabai Chanu Wins Gold at 2025 Commonwealth Weightlifting

Indian weightlifting icon Mirabai Chanu has once again proven her mettle on the international stage by clinching gold at the 2025 Commonwealth Weightlifting Championships held in Ahmedabad. This victory marks her powerful comeback to competitive lifting, adding another illustrious chapter to her storied career.

Record-Breaking Performance in Ahmedabad

A Dominant Display

Competing in the women’s 48kg category, Mirabai delivered a flawless performance by lifting a total of 193kg, breaking all existing Commonwealth Championship records,

  • 84kg in snatch
  • 109kg in clean and jerk
  • 193kg total lift

Each of these lifts set new championship records, showcasing her unmatched form and dominance in the event.

Securing Glasgow 2026 Spot

Beyond the medals and records, this victory holds strategic importance: it guarantees direct qualification for the 2026 Commonwealth Games in Glasgow. This early qualification allows Chanu to shift focus to Olympic preparation, positioning her strongly for future global competitions.

A Triumphant Comeback

Return to Competitive Action

This gold medal marks Mirabai’s return to competition after a brief hiatus, and the win reaffirms her status as one of India’s most reliable and decorated athletes. Her resilience, consistency, and commitment continue to inspire a new generation of lifters.

Continuing a Legacy of Excellence

Mirabai’s latest triumph adds to a list of accolades that includes,

  • Silver at Tokyo Olympics 2020
  • Gold at Commonwealth Games 2018 and 2022
  • Multiple international records and titles in the 48kg and 49kg categories

Her win in Ahmedabad further cements her legacy in the sport and boosts India’s standing in international weightlifting.
